Mock-Ups & Labaratory Tests

Our team can design and produce a 3D virtual or real size 1:1 unitised façade prototype – mock-up. It is a full-size structural model made with the exact design techniques and materials that will be used in a project. A mock-up allows the architects, contractors, and developers to assess a real-life representation of a facade unit design, so that functionality, aesthetics, and quality can be evaluated down to the smallest detail of the upcoming project.

Testing

Laboratory mock-up testing provides an opportunity to determine the efficiency and safety of the system, its design, fabrication, and connection performance between systems. Upon approval, that sets the standard for all the work to be done on the project.

The benefit of the mock-up testing is easy to spot:

  • to test a final design solution on a small scale in order to make sure that everything is right on a grand scale;
  • in the long run it reduces many risks;
  • can save time;
  • helps to avoid unnecessary waste

Our mock-ups are being tested by Rosenheim University specialists in Germany.

Variety of Laboratory Tests

We usually perform tests such as air permeability, water tightness static, resistance to wind load and fire, also airborne sound insulation. If another type of laboratory testing is requested, we can arrange and provide all necessary technical evidence of the product’s quality and parameters. For projects where the design can accommodate standard curtain wall systems, pre-construction laboratory testing is not required.

Building Information Modeling (BIM) Approach

KGC designers & engineers perform BIM design in the 3Dexperience environment. We are one of the few companies that use the BIM model in our production. Using BIM helps us to improve the efficiency of the construction processes, reduce waste and improve the quality of the buildings. It also helps to enhance facade technology design and systems analysis, construction planning, management, communication and coordination between designers, fabricators, contractors, and installers. Overall, BIM helps to improve facade’s technical performance.

In-House Production

Annual Façade Production Capacity 200 000 m2

At both factories in Lithuania, where production and storage room space exceed 20 400 sq. meters, and we have 10 assembly lines. Each production process is subject to continuous optimization and controlled with KPI’s regarding LEAN methods.

This allows us to speed up production processes, as well as to reduce and optimize production costs. KGC continuously invests in the most modern technologies and aims to quickly react to changing and increasing customer needs. In 2023, our investment in machinery reached almost 2 million. Euros.

Our high-end CNC machines in both factories include:

  • Schüco AS 100 processing centre
  • Two 5-axis CNC machines Schüco AF 510
  • Schüco AF 310,
  • Schüco AF 450
  • Schüco AF 500

Our equipment processes not only aluminum profiles used for windows, doors and facades but also produces steel thermal profiles and various bent tin-plate products, which are broadly used in aluminum-glass constructions. Tin and steel bending equipment allow us to independently produce bent units necessary for aluminum constructions and optimize the production completion process even further. Therefore, we are less dependent on suppliers of such production.

Installation Process

For every project, we carry out construction site situation analysis and prepare detailed project installation methodology, which is presented to our customers. Depending on a building’s size and height the installation method is then chosen. Our team can work with all types of equipment: spider, tower, mobile cranes or monorail system. Our goal is to spend as little time as possible at the construction site to help customers to implement the project faster and reduce costs. We deliver our prefabricated products on time and in advance so that the installation process will be continuous and uninterrupted.
